What can affect self disclosure?

Several factors can affect self-disclosure, including trust in the relationship, cultural norms, fear of rejection or judgment, past experiences, and the level of intimacy between the individuals involved. People may choose to disclose more or less depending on these factors.

What are the age factors that affect relearning speech and mobility after stroke?

Age can impact relearning speech and mobility after a stroke due to factors such as reduced neuroplasticity, slower recovery processes, and potential comorbidities. Older individuals may have more difficulty relearning these skills compared to younger individuals due to these age-related factors. Rehabilitation strategies may need to be tailored to address the specific needs of older stroke survivors.

What is relative rights?

Relative rights refer to rights that are considered in relation to the rights of others. These rights can vary depending on the context and may be limited by the interests or rights of other individuals or groups. An example is the right to free speech, which may be restricted in certain situations to protect other rights or prevent harm.
